If you have any questions, you can contact our managers in any convenient way for you.

ETC5780 - Flywheel for Land Rover Defender - Fits 2.5 Naturally Aspirated and Turbo Diesel - 5 Bearing Crank (Part Number: ETC5780)

ETC5780 - Flywheel for Land Rover Defender - Fits 2.5 Naturally Aspirated and Turbo Diesel - 5 Bearing Crank
Availability: Pre-order

635.50€
Product Details
Part Number: ETC5780

Write a review